That\u2019s more than twice the number of people who use cocaine, according to the U.S. National Survey of Drug Use and Health.<\/p>\n<p class=MsoNormal style='margin-bottom:0cm;margin-bottom:.0001pt;text-indent: 18.0pt;line-height:normal'>A 2006 study reported in <i>Drug and Alcohol Dependence<\/i> found that large numbers of people are using the Internet to search for and trade advice on how to tamper with prescription drugs. Edward Cone, author of the study and a toxicologist at ConeChem Research in Maryland, explains: \u201cDrug misusers are tampering with the drugs to get high, and you get high by getting the drug in faster or giving a bigger dose. All of these drugs are toxic or lethal at certain levels, so this is a very real health issue. In the U.S., the abuse of pharmaceutical drugs is reaching epidemic proportions.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=MsoNormal style='margin-bottom:0cm;margin-bottom:.0001pt;text-indent: 18.0pt;line-height:normal'>Abuse of prescription drugs by teens and young adults in particular is on the rise. Drug counselors are getting numerous reports of pill-popping get-togethers called \u201cpharm parties\u201d at which teens trade prescription drugs like baseball cards. According to a 2005 survey by the Partnership for a Drug-Free America, 19 percent of U.S. teenagers\u2014roughly 4.5 million\u2014reported having taken prescription painkillers such as Vicodin or OxyContin, or stimulants such as Ritalin or Adderall, to get high.<\/p>\n<p class=MsoNormal style='margin-bottom:0cm;margin-bottom:.0001pt;text-indent: 18.0pt;line-height:normal'>In May 2006, the U.S.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ration reported that overdoses of prescription and over-the-counter drugs accounted for about one-fourth of the 1.3 million drug-related emergency room admissions in 2004.<\/p>\n<p class=MsoNormal align=right style='margin-bottom:0cm;margin-bottom:.0001pt; text-align:right;line-height:normal'>\u2014Hazel Muir, \u201cAbuse of Prescription Drugs Fueled by Online Recipes,\u201d NewScientist.com (June 2006); Donna Leinwand, \u201cPrescription Drugs Find Place in Teen Culture,\u201d <i>USA Today<\/i> (June 12, 2006)<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Topics: Addiction; Desires; Drugs; Lawlessness; Pleasure; Teens; Temptation; Vices References: Romans 6:16; 12:2; 13:13\u201314; Ephesians 5:18; 1 Peter 5:8; 2 Peter 2:19 In 2003, 6.3 million people were misusing prescription drugs, such as stimulants, painkillers, sedatives, and tranquilizers.
